SAP-数据库备份:方案二:使用DUMP DATABASE命令备份
方案二:使用DUMP DATABASE命令备份
步骤如下:
- dump备份my_database的数据库。
DUMP DATABASE my_database TO '/local_dump_dir/my_database.dump'
- dump my_database的事务日志。
DUMP TRANSACTION my_database TO '/local_dump_dir/my_database.$timestamp.dumptran'
- 将本地文件备份到SFS或OBS。
- 恢复数据库。
- 恢复前停止数据库。
- 恢复数据库。
LOAD DATABASE my_database FROM "my_database.dump"
LOAD TRAN my_database FROM "my_database.$timestamp.dumptran"
- 恢复后启动数据库。
增量备份前需要设置trunc log on chkpt参数为false。命令如下:
sp_dboption my_database, "trunc log on chkpt", false